2. What Are Foam Filled Fenders?
Foam filled fenders are buoyant protective devices designed to absorb the energy generated during collisions between vessels and docking structures. They come in various shapes and sizes, often resembling cylindrical or spherical forms. These fenders are filled with high-density foam, providing excellent cushioning and protection without the risk of puncturing or deflating, unlike traditional inflatable fenders.

3.1 Enhanced Safety Measures
Safety is a top priority in maritime operations. Foam filled fenders significantly reduce the risk of damage to both the vessel and the dock. Their robust construction allows them to absorb the kinetic energy from impacts, thereby preventing structural damage. The foam's inherent buoyancy ensures that the fenders remain in position, providing a consistent protective barrier against potential accidents.
3.2 Cost-Effectiveness Over Time
While the initial investment in foam filled fenders may be higher than other types, their long-term cost-effectiveness is undeniable. These fenders require minimal maintenance and have a long lifespan, typically lasting years without the need for replacement. Their durability means fewer repairs and replacements, ultimately saving money for vessel operators.
3.3 Environmental Advantages
Foam filled fenders are also an environmentally friendly choice. Their materials are often made from non-toxic, recyclable substances, minimizing the ecological impact. Unlike inflatable fenders that may contain harmful gases, foam filled options do not pose a risk of environmental contamination, making them suitable for sensitive marine ecosystems.
3.4 Ease of Use and Installation
Another significant advantage of foam filled fenders is their ease of use. They do not require inflation, which means that they can be deployed quickly and efficiently. Their lightweight nature allows for easy handling and installation, making them ideal for various docking scenarios. Additionally, these fenders are less prone to damage from sharp objects, reducing the chances of operational delays.

5. Maintenance and Care for Foam Filled Fenders
Maintaining foam filled fenders is relatively straightforward compared to other fender types. Regular inspections should be conducted to check for any signs of wear or damage. Cleaning the fenders with freshwater and mild soap can help extend their lifespan. It’s also advisable to store them in a sheltered area when not in use to protect them from harsh environmental conditions.
6. Installation Guide for Foam Filled Fenders
The installation of foam filled fenders is a simple process that can typically be completed in a few steps:
1. **Select the Right Size**: Choose a fender size based on the vessel's size and the docking conditions.
2. **Positioning**: Determine the best location for the fender on the vessel or dock.
3. **Securing**: Use robust mounting hardware to attach the fender securely. Ensure that it's firmly in place to prevent movement during impacts.
4. **Testing**: Conduct a quick test to ensure the fender is functioning as intended before the vessel approaches the dock.
